exponenta event banner

createNotifier

Создание уведомителя КИП для X_TRADER

Описание

пример

createNotifier(X,S) создает xtrdr уведомитель КИПиА, определенный структурой S с полями, соответствующими допустимым параметрам API X_TRADER®. Для получения дополнительной информации посмотрите Торговый Technologies® X_TRADER API RTD Tutorial или Ссылку Класса API X_TRADER.

пример

createNotifier(X,Name,Value) создает уведомитель прибора с использованием опций API X_TRADER указанных одним или несколькими Name,Value объединение аргументов с именами и значениями, соответствующими допустимым параметрам API X_TRADER. Для получения дополнительной информации см. API Trading Technologies X_TRADER Обучающая программа RTD или Ссылка Класса API X_TRADER.

Примеры

свернуть все

Начните X_TRADER.

X = xtrdr;

Определите структуру ввода, S, с полями, соответствующими допустимым параметрам API X_TRADER.

S = [];
S.UpdateFilter = '';
S.EnablePriceUpdates = -1;
S.EnableDepthUpdates = 0;
S.DebugLogLevel = 3;
S.EnableOrderSetUpdates = -1;
S.DeliverAllPriceUpdates = 0;
S
S = 

  struct with fields:

              UpdateFilter: ''
        EnablePriceUpdates: -1
        EnableDepthUpdates: 0
             DebugLogLevel: 3
     EnableOrderSetUpdates: -1
    DeliverAllPriceUpdates: 0

Создание xtrdr уведомитель прибора.

createNotifier(X,S)

Закройте соединение.

close(X)

Начните X_TRADER.

X = xtrdr;

Создание xtrdr с использованием пар «имя-значение», соответствующих допустимым параметрам API X_TRADER.

createNotifier(X,'UpdateFilter','','EnablePriceUpdates',-1, ...
    'EnableDepthUpdates',0,'DebugLogLevel',3, ...
    'EnableOrderSetUpdates',-1,'DeliverAllPriceUpdates',0)

Закройте соединение.

close(X)

Входные аргументы

свернуть все

X_TRADER соединение, указанное как объект соединения, созданный с помощью xtrdr.

xtrdr структура ввода, заданная с полями, соответствующими допустимым параметрам API X_TRADER. Для получения дополнительной информации см. API Trading Technologies X_TRADER Обучающая программа RTD или Ссылка Класса API X_TRADER.

Пример: S = [];
S.Exchange = 'Eurex';
S.Product = 'OGBM';
S.ProdType = 'Option';
S.Contract = 'Jan12 P12300';
S.Alias = 'TestInstrument3';

Типы данных: struct

Аргументы пары «имя-значение»

Укажите дополнительные пары, разделенные запятыми Name,Value аргументы. Name является именем аргумента и Value - соответствующее значение. Name должен отображаться внутри кавычек. Можно указать несколько аргументов пары имен и значений в любом порядке как Name1,Value1,...,NameN,ValueN.

Пример: createNotifier(X,'UpdateFilter','','EnablePriceUpdates',-1,'EnableDepthUpdates',0,'DebugLogLevel',3,'EnableOrderSetUpdates',-1,'DeliverAllPriceUpdates',0) создает xtrdr уведомитель прибора, использующий допустимые параметры API.

Действительные варианты API X_TRADER, определенные как вектор характера или скаляр последовательности использование деталей, описали в API Trading Technologies X_TRADER Обучающую программу RTD или Ссылку Класса API X_TRADER.

Пример: createNotifier(X,'UpdateFilter','','EnablePriceUpdates',-1,'EnableDepthUpdates',0,'DebugLogLevel',3,'EnableOrderSetUpdates',-1,'DeliverAllPriceUpdates',0)

Типы данных: char | string

Действительные варианты API X_TRADER, определенные как вектор характера или скаляр последовательности использование деталей, описали в API Trading Technologies X_TRADER Обучающую программу RTD или Ссылку Класса API X_TRADER.

Пример: createNotifier(X,'UpdateFilter','','EnablePriceUpdates',-1,'EnableDepthUpdates',0,'DebugLogLevel',3,'EnableOrderSetUpdates',-1,'DeliverAllPriceUpdates',0)

Типы данных: char | string

Представлен в R2013a